MAKE CONNECTIONS Ø The ENCODE pilot project found that at least 75% of the genome is transcribed into RNAs, far more than could be accounted for by proteiri-coding genes. Review Concepts 17.3 and 18.3 and suggest some roles that these RNAs might play.
